Description

A finely executed seascape watercolour by artist tb hardy 1874. In rough seas and blue skies, lovely feel and movement to the scene. Overall excellent condition remounted in original frame. From a private collection

Dimensions:

80cm wide

62cm tall

3cm deep

19th-century British maritime art focuses on detailed depictions of naval vessels, coastal vistas, and shipping channels, capturing the maritime trade and naval power of the era with emphasis on atmospheric light and realistic water textures.

Victorian artists frequently utilised watercolour or oil pigments on paper, canvas, or board, often mounting the finished works under glass within solid oak, mahogany, or gilt wood frames.

Authentic pieces generally display period-correct artist signatures or inscriptions, natural age-related paper toning, original framing construction, and mid-to-late Victorian pigment techniques.

Seascape artwork can be hung above a mantelpiece or sideboard to create a focal point, pairing well with neutral wall tones, traditional timber furniture, and dark leather upholstery.

Watercolours must be displayed away from direct sunlight and high humidity to prevent pigment fading and paper degradation, utilizing UV-protective glass and conservation mounting materials where possible.
